Dwarf Alberta Spruce Bonsai - 5 Years Later

Ever see those red potted spruce tree's at the home goods store during Christmas? Well I went through a bunch till I found one I liked - this is 5 years later. All work is done in January/ February on my spruce - Right in the middle of winter when the sap is not flowing. Repotting done after the last frost of winter.
